Abstract
Existing and planned neutrino detectors, sensitive in the energy regime from 10^{17} eV to 10^{23} eV, offer opportunities for particle physics and cosmology. In this contribution, we discuss particularly the possibilities to infer information about physics beyond the Standard Model at center-of-mass energies beyond the reach of the Large Hadron Collider, as well as to detect big bang relic neutrinos via absorption dips in the observed neutrino spectra.
